Erosion Control Installation in Honolulu, HI

Erosion control installation services help protect properties from the damaging effects of soil erosion caused by heavy rain, wind, or runoff. This service typically involves installing barriers, retaining walls, silt fences, or ground cover to stabilize slopes, gardens, and landscaped areas. Homeowners often seek erosion control when working on new landscaping projects, hillside repairs, or property upgrades that require preventing soil loss and maintaining the integrity of their land.

Before requesting erosion control installation, property owners usually want to understand the types of solutions available for their specific site conditions and the best options to prevent future erosion. It’s helpful to consider the size and slope of the area, the type of soil, and the level of water runoff during storms. Clear information about the project scope and site conditions can ensure the appropriate measures are chosen to effectively protect the property.

Project Types

Common Erosion Control Installation Jobs

Silt Fence Installation - helps prevent soil erosion on construction sites and landscaped areas.

Matting and Mulching - stabilizes slopes and minimizes runoff during heavy rains.

Retaining Wall Erosion Control - reduces soil movement around retaining structures and garden beds.

Drainage System Setup - directs water away from foundations to prevent erosion damage.

Streambank Stabilization - protects natural waterways from erosion caused by water flow.

Erosion Control Blankets - provides temporary stabilization for disturbed soil on slopes and disturbed land.

FAQ

Erosion Control Installation Questions

What is erosion control installation? It involves placing barriers, plants, or structures to prevent soil from washing away during heavy rain or runoff.

What types of erosion control methods are used? Common methods include silt fences, erosion mats, retaining walls, and revegetation with native plants.

Why is erosion control important for property owners? It helps protect land stability, prevents property damage, and maintains landscape integrity after storms or heavy rainfall.

When should erosion control measures be installed? Installation is recommended before periods of heavy rain or when preparing land for construction or landscaping projects.
